French-born Star Targeted By Eric Chelle Nets First Premier League Goal As West Ham Draw Southampton

French-born midfielder Lesley Ugochukwu netted a dramatic stoppage-time equaliser to secure a 1-1 draw for Southampton against West Ham United at the London Stadium on Saturday, Soccernet.ng reports .
The 21-year-old, on loan from Chelsea, scored his first-ever Premier League goal in what was his 34th top-flight appearance across two seasons - 12 with Chelsea last term and 22 so far this campaign with the Saints. Ugochukwus only previous senior goal came in France's Ligue 1 for Rennes during the 2021-22 season.
Jarrod Bowen had put West Ham ahead shortly after the break, cutting inside to curl a left-footed effort past the goalkeeper in the 47th minute. That appeared to set the Hammers on course for their first win in six matches.
However, with the home side retreating deeper and making defensive substitutions in the closing stages, Southampton pushed forward and were rewarded in stoppage time.
Kyle Walker-Peters made an enterprising run into the box and his attempted cross was deflected. The loose ball dropped invitingly for Ugochukwu, who struck a sweet volley into the bottom corner to level the scores.
